Quick Tips on Preventing Water Pollution from Paints
When using paints and other Household Hazardous Wastes (HHW) in and around your home, remember that it’s important to dispose of these materials properly to prevent water pollution. NEVER dump old paint or wash paint brushes into storm drains, ditches or gutters, which lead directly to creeks and streams. For latex paint, wash the brushes out in sinks or toilets located inside your house which lead to the sanitary sewer. If you have a septic tank, paint brushes can never be washed out into drains or toilets in your house. If left over paint cannot be used-up, given away, recycled, or solidify it with kitty litter and dispose of it in the trash.
In case of solvent based paints, it’s important to never wash out the brushes even in the sinks inside your home which connect to sanitary sewer. Doing so could cause complications. Read and follow all label directions regarding brush cleaning. Dispose of waste solvents properly.
